Настройка отчета СКД
Добрый День!
Перерыл кучу материалов по СКД и не смог найти ответ на вопрос, как создать подобный отчет на СКД.
В данном отчете имеется 2 основных набора данных.
1. Данные из табличной части "Заказ на производства"
2. Данные из справочника "Спецификации".
Важно, что бы к одной из строк Изделия приклеивались материалы - их может быть различное количество более одной запимси.
поле "Спецификация" в наборе данных №2 показана справочно как поле для соединения двух наборов данных.
Перерыл кучу материалов по СКД и не смог найти ответ на вопрос, как создать подобный отчет на СКД.
В данном отчете имеется 2 основных набора данных.
1. Данные из табличной части "Заказ на производства"
2. Данные из справочника "Спецификации".
Важно, что бы к одной из строк Изделия приклеивались материалы - их может быть различное количество более одной запимси.
поле "Спецификация" в наборе данных №2 показана справочно как поле для соединения двух наборов данных.
Прикрепленные файлы:
По теме из базы знаний
Ответы
В избранное
Подписаться на ответы
Сортировка:
Древо развёрнутое
Свернуть все
(1) Если сложность заключается в том, как объединить строки по заказу в одну для разных позиций материалов, то одними настройками СКД здесь не обойтись. Придется после формирования отчета обрабатывать результат (табличный документ), объединяя нужные ячейки.
Ну либо напротив, отдельные строки таблицы материалов сворачивать в одну, где текст разных ячеек будет разделен символом переноса строки.
Ну либо напротив, отдельные строки таблицы материалов сворачивать в одну, где текст разных ячеек будет разделен символом переноса строки.
(2)В таком случае в отчете будет большое количество Изделий и к каждому изделию будет сопоставляться по несколько строк материалов из спецификации. Соответственно вопрос. Как правильнее будет соединить эти два набора данных перед обработкой соединения ячеек по изделиям?
(4) Не могу сказать, что я до конца понял вопрос. Соединять наборы нужно как и прежде. Настраиваете отчет как умеете, например, просто выводите детальные записи. В результате изделие у Вас будет повторяться несколько раз, для каждой строки материала. В обработчике "ПриКомпоновкеРезультата" отключаете стандартную обработку, выводите отчет программно, а затем программно же объединяете нужные ячейки.
(1)Группируем по "изделию спецификации", потом группируем по материалу, а далее в настройках отчета "Другие настройки", параметр "Расположение группировок" ставим "Отдельно и только в итогах". Вид конечно будет не прям такой как на скриншоте, согласно заданию группировка должна быть правильной.
(11)
1. Сделать вычисляемое поле, не ресурс, для вычисления количества изделий, на основании поля КоличествоИзделий. С формулой примерно ВычислитьВыражние("Сумма(КоличествоИзделия)","Изделие,Спецификация",)
2. Использовать не группировку, а таблицу. В строки добавить группировки - Изделие, спецификация, вычисляемое поле с количеством изделия. В подчиненную группировку Материал и спецификация.
В колонки добавить Количество материала.
1. Сделать вычисляемое поле, не ресурс, для вычисления количества изделий, на основании поля КоличествоИзделий. С формулой примерно ВычислитьВыражние("Сумма(КоличествоИзделия)","Изделие,Спецификация",)
2. Использовать не группировку, а таблицу. В строки добавить группировки - Изделие, спецификация, вычисляемое поле с количеством изделия. В подчиненную группировку Материал и спецификация.
В колонки добавить Количество материала.
(15) Вот схема компоновки. Можно через консоль СКД открыть, либо загрузить во внешний отчет...
Прикрепленные файлы:
РтчетПоДефициту.xml
Вакансии
Аналитик 1С / Бизнес-аналитик
Нижний Новгород
зарплата от 100 000 руб. до 250 000 руб.
Временный (на проект)
Нижний Новгород
зарплата от 100 000 руб. до 250 000 руб.
Временный (на проект)